The Scene – When Natalie Tessler couldn't find a decent manicure in the Loop, she opened her own body-boosting, soul-soothing spa downtown. The result: a clean, comfortable place to trade in business-casual for plush white robes and slippers. Unwind in the New-Age-y "relaxation room" until an amiable escort leads you to your treatment room. – – The Services – Dry skin loves the "Buff and Drench," a rejuvenating body wrap that exfoliates and moisturizes you inside a warm paraffin cocoon. Located on the west edge of Chicago's Loop, Spa Space combines a customized approach to massage, skin, and nail care with a luxury atmosphere focused on exceptional customer service. The combination appeals to men and women seeking goal-oriented treatments while enjoying the benefits of relaxation and stress reduction. The extensive 7,500 sq. ft. facility includes 14 treatment rooms, locker rooms with relaxation areas, steam and rainshowers, a private party room, a room for side-by-side couples treatments, and a boutique carrying top-tier brands such as Kiehl's since 1851, Sonya Dakar, Skinceuticals, Anthony Logistics, and others. The layout suits both private enjoyment and group events. Since launching in 2001, Spa Space has received extensive national acclaim and awards for excellence in service, unique treatments and products, and its fresh approach to treating both men and women.
